A specialist endodontist is a dentist who focuses exclusively on saving teeth through root canal treatment and related procedures. After completing dental school, endodontists undertake three or more additional years of advanced postgraduate training in endodontics.
This specialist education equips endodontists with advanced skills in diagnosing and managing complex oral and facial pain, treating traumatic dental injuries, identifying cracked teeth, and performing procedures designed to preserve natural teeth.
By limiting their practice solely to endodontic care, endodontists gain extensive experience in both routine and highly complex cases, including root canal treatment, root canal retreatment, and endodontic microsurgery.
Endodontists utilise the most advanced technology available in the field, allowing for greater precision, efficiency, and predictability of outcomes. This often results in a more comfortable patient experience and faster healing.
During treatment, endodontists may use:
🦷 Dental 3D imaging – Endodontists sometimes require cone beam computed technology (CBCT) to provide highly detailed, in-depth images of the tooth structure and its surroundings, revealing minute details that can’t be seen with traditional X-ray technology. Using CBCT supports better diagnoses of underlying pain and other tooth symptoms, helping to identify the optimal approach to treatment.
🦷 Dental surgical microscope – Endodontics focuses on the internal structures of teeth, tiny areas that can be extremely difficult to fully examine with the naked eye. Dental surgical microscopes allow the endodontist to visualise the internal structure of teeth in extreme detail, with magnifications of x 25!
🦷 Electronic apex locator – The apex is the very end of the tooth root, and determining where it’s located plays a critical role in making sure your root canal procedure is performed with the highest accuracy and precision. This tool helps determine the total length of the canal, ensuring the entire canal is cleaned, treated, and filled, resulting in less chance of reinfection and further retreatment
🦷 Endodontic ultrasonic – Ultrasonic dental instruments use the power of high-frequency energy to provide extra, in-depth care for long-term benefits and the best possible results. An ultrasonic gently and thoroughly removes decay and debris, including old filling materials whilst efficiently disinfecting the canals.
